A bust of Princess Marie Zéphirine de Bourbon,
porcelain, polychromed and gilt, height: 15 cm, blossoms minimally chipped, Vienna, Imperial Manufactory, impressed Austrian shield, year no. 1850, modeller 1 Franz Dunkel 1840-1856 (Ru)
The present bust is based on a model by J. J. Kändler ca. 1753 in Meissen. In 1753, Kändler drew an authentic portrait with blue eyes from a sitting in Paris. The bust was commissioned by her grandfather August III, King of Poland and Prince Elector of Saxony;
